    To understand how far our League has come in such a short time, the board felt it was important to outline where we have come from.
    Back in the fall of 2007, Houlton area baseball began a transformation with a group of parents, coaches, and volunteers, to breathe new life into a sport that all parties believed, if successful, would be something that the Houlton community could be proud of.
    This group agreed to incorporate and charter with Little League and become Houlton Area Little League. A board of directors was elected and the board immediately began outlining our short-term goals for the league. The goals were ambitious, including; the introduction of Little League softball, the Field of Dreams project, and hosting a District Three Little League tournament.
    In the spring of 2008, Houlton Area Little League offered softball to girls ages 9 to 12 years old. An entire infrastructure was created, including purchasing uniforms and equipment, scheduling games, selecting volunteer coaches and umpires, and educating parents and girls to this new opportunity. We have just completed our third year of Little League softball and the board is pleased with the progress. The board is also excited about the future with softball, because there is so much room for growth in this sport.
    Also, in the spring of 2008, the Field of Dreams project began with the goal to have four new baseball/softball fields to allow more opportunities for children in Houlton to play baseball of softball. With the help of donations from area businesses, we have now completed two new baseball/softball fields. We continue to push forward with this project, but feel tremendous pride in the completion of the first two fields!
    Dozens of coaches, players, parents, and other District Three leadership from the greater Bangor area northward, have expressed how great all of our baseball/softball facilities here are in our community, and this is something we are extremely proud of. We also greatly appreciate all of the support that our League continues to receive from the employees of Houlton’s Parks and Recreation Department, for the maintenance and upkeep of the two Little League ball fields in Community Park, as well as the support from the SAD 29 staff who have supported the creation of our additional ball fields.
    In 2009, Houlton Area Little League hosted the 11/12 District Three Softball All-Star tournament. This tournament, while successful, was a precursor to the tournament that was hosted in 2010. The 9/10 tournament brought 14 teams, as well as hundreds of spectators, to Houlton for a two and a half week, double-elimination tournament. Many volunteers contributed to the success of the tournament including umpires, scorekeepers, announcers, pitch counters, ground crews, concessions, and clean-up crews.
